#4ffd5b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ffd5b is composed of 31% red, 99.2%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 64%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 65.1%. #4ffd5b color hex could be obtained by blending #9effb6 with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#4ffd5b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ffd5b has RGB values of R:79, G:253, B:91 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5242203.

Shades and Tints of #4ffd5b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ffd5b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1aba2 is the less saturated color, while #4ffd5b is the most saturated one.
